JBM Auto Limited has issued a clarification regarding a significant increase in trading volume observed in its shares. In response to an email from BSE Limited dated 24th August 2026, the company stated that it has made all necessary disclosures as per Regulation 30 of S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015.
The company emphasized that it has not withheld any material or price-sensitive information and has consistently complied with the disclosure requirements for all material events and price-sensitive information to the stock exchanges from time to time. Therefore, JBM Auto Limited concluded that the observed volumes in its shares are purely market-driven.
The clarification was provided by Sanjeev Kumar, Company Secretary & Compliance Officer, for JBM Auto Limited.
